Regional Health & Safety Manager

Yorkshire

Salary up to £70,000 per annum depending on experience + company car or allowance + 13.75% bonus scheme

Are you a HSQE Manager looking for a role where you can make an impact across the organisation? As this company grows, they are keen to add to their team a dynamic and adaptable Safety professional that can work closely with the SHEQ Director to help the company evolve and design the Safety culture of the business moving forward!

The Role

The role will be to manager a small HSQE team within your region, this will involve providing support and guidance to enable to team to develop their skills and knowledge further.
You will be experienced in the drive and implementation of a positive HSQE culture across the regional projects, while also supporting and leading on investigations of incidents.
As the Manager, you will be responsible for maintaining compliance for the Principal Contractor Licence, RISQS and Achilles Certifications and ISO Certifications.
Requirement

It will be beneficial to have a background within the Rail Civil Engineering / Construction sector, within a H&S position.
Experience of a managing a team
It is preferred that you will hold a NVQ 5 / NVQ 6 / Degree with Health & Safety.
Quality / Auditing certifications
